Principles of data structures in c++ pdf

Introduction to data structure darshan institute of. Notes on data structures and programming techniques computer. The data structures we use in this book are found in the. Phrase searching you can use double quotes to search for a series of words in a particular order. This page intentionally left blank copyright 2006, new age. To do this requires competence in principles 1, 2, and 3. Click download or read online button to get data structures algorithms and software principles in c book now. How to download the solution manual for adts, data. Principles of data structures using c and c free ebooks. A cstring is stored as a sequence of chars, terminated by the null character which is denoted \0 and has value 0 as an int.

The material is unified by the use of recurring themes such as efficiency, recursion, representation and tradeoffs. This page intentionally left blank copyright 2006, new age international p ltd. Download data structures algorithms and software principles in c pdf book pdf free download link or read online here in pdf. They embed the design and implementation of data structures into the practice of sound software design principles that are introduced early and reinforced by 20 case studies. Data structures succinctly part 1, syncfusion pdf, kindle email address requested, not required data structures succinctly part 2, syncfusion pdf, kindle email address requested, not required. This book describes many techniques for representing data. Using c, this book develops the concepts and theory of data structures and algorithm analysis step by step, proceeding from concrete examples to abstract principles. C and data structures textbook free download askvenkat books. Hansen, jan 1, 1986, data structures computer science, 505 pages. In this chapter, we develop the concept of a collection by. Data structure design a very influential book by niklaus wirth on learning how to program is called precisely. Always update books hourly, if not looking, search in the book search column. Data structures, algorithms, and software principles in c standish, thomas a.

Then, once a programmer has learned the principles of clear program design and implementation, the next step is to study the effects of data organization and algorithms on program ef. Data structures in pascal, edward martin reingold, wilfred j. It is also suitable for nit calicut deemed university, anna university, up technical university. Citations 0 references 0 researchgate has not been able to resolve any citations for this publication. In later chapters, the book explains the basic algorithm design paradigms, such as the greedy approach and the divideandconquer approach, which are used to solve a large variety of computational problems. All books are in clear copy here, and all files are secure so dont worry about it. Aug 20, 2019 read data structures, algorithms, and software principles in c pdf ebook by thomas a. A practical introduction to data structures and algorithm. Wildcard searching if you want to search for multiple variations of a word, you can substitute a special symbol called a wildcard for one or more letters. Data type is a way to classify various types of data such as integer, string, etc. Data structures and algorithms, 2003, computers, 347 pages. Sep 23, 2016 for the love of physics walter lewin may 16, 2011 duration.

Principles of data structures using c and free pdf. Each data structure and each algorithm has costs and bene. Data structure using c and c tanenbaum pdf free download. C data structures and algorithm design principles ebook. Get ebooks c data structures and algorithm design principles on pdf, epub, tuebl, mobi and audiobook for free. As i have taught data structures through the years, i have found that design issues have played an ever greater role in my courses. Commonly asked data structure interview questions set 1.

It also helps to develop students understanding of the basic. Data abstraction, classes, and abstract data types 33 programming example. Read online data structures algorithms and software principles in c pdf book pdf free download link book now. A data structure is a way of organizing the data so that the data can be used efficiently. The study of data structures is essential to every one who comes across with computer science. Programmers must learn to assess application needs.

However, even for the programs we are trying to solve in this course, we sometimes need to know the basics of data structure. Here you can download the free data structures pdf notes ds notes pdf latest and old materials with multiple file links to download. For example, world war ii with quotes will give more precise results than world war ii without quotes. Each new data structure is introduced by describing its interface. In 199091, he became the fourth winner of university of california irvines distinguished faculty lectureship for teaching, the campus highest distinction for teaching excellence. This article will present countermeasures to failure based on three principles that should govern how data warehouses are built. Is103 computational thinking handout on fundamental data. This site is like a library, use search box in the. This site is like a library, use search box in the widget to get ebook that you want. Structures are used to represent a record, suppose you want to keep track of your books in a library. This course introduces students to the underlying principles of data structures and algorithms.

The user must ensure that the null terminator remains present. Important software engineering principles are also covered, including modularity, abstract data types. There are more than 1 million books that have been enjoyed by people from all over the world. Data structures and algorithms is a ten week course, consisting of three hours per week lecture, plus assigned reading, weekly quizzes and five homework projects. This chapter explains the basic terms related to data structure. Balaguruswamy was one of the famous authors who wrote about the c programming and data structures in simple language useful to create notes. Pradyumansinh jadeja 9879461848 2702 data structure 1 introduction to data structure computer is an electronic machine which is used for data processing and manipulation. Introduction to data structures through c data structures. For example, when a program sends parameters to a function, the param eters are placed on the stack.

Data structures algorithms and software principles in c. Fundamentals of data structures ellis horowitz, sartaj sahni. Following these data warehouse concepts should help you as a data warehouse developer to navigate the development journey avoiding the common potholes or even sinkholes of bi implementations. A practical introduction to data structures and algorithm analysis. Pdf data structures, algorithms, and software principles in. Standish is the chairman of computer science at the university of california, irvine. This is an excellent, uptodate and easytouse text on data structures and algorithms that is intended for undergraduates in. Read online data structures, algorithms, and software principles in c pdf, 10101994. Using c, this book develops the concepts and theory of data structures and algorithm analysis. This is primarily a class in the c programming language, and introduces the student to data structure design and implementation. When programmer collects such type of data for processing, he would require to store all of them in computers main memory.

In this textbook, he explained basics which were easy to understand ever for starters. Array, list, files, linked list, trees and graphs fall in this category. Basic introduction into algorithms and data structures the opening chapters introduce the ideas behind oop and. The study of data structures is an essential subject of every under graduate and. Explore data structures such as arrays, stacks, and graphs with realworld examples study the tradeoffs between algorithms and data structures and discover what works and what doesnt. Data structures algorithms and software principles in c pdf. Share this article with your classmates and friends so that they can also follow latest study materials and notes on engineering subjects. Fundamentals of data structures ellis horowitz, sartaj. Data structures, algorithms, and software principles in c by thomas a. Principles of data structures using c and c download ebook. Data structures, algorithms, and software principles in c.

346 280 775 1479 896 34 739 367 46 870 1338 443 991 377 639 465 1182 1220 156 1501 1341 346 489 289 929 20 657 1007 1001 1566 1461 98 911 744 1477 160 1461 714